Abstract

The bay-substitution of perylene diimide molecules with fused aromatic rings affects both the core structure and the aggregation properties. The photovoltaic performance of P3HT:perylene diimide solar cells show efficiencies twofold higher than the best result obtained in the literature for similar devices.
